Taco Bell

  3.5 – 537 reviews  $ • Fast food restaurant Find your nearby Taco Bell at 2110 South 11th Street in Nebraska …

Read more

Parker’s Smokehouse

  4.2 – 38 reviews  $$ • Restaurant Address and Contact Information Address: 715 1st Corso, Nebraska City, NE 68410 Phone: (402) …

Read more

Timbers

  4.4 – 329 reviews   • American restaurant ✔️ Dine-in ✔️ Takeout ✔️ No delivery Hours Sunday 7 AM–2 PM, 5–9 PM Monday (Labor …

Read more